🏰 The 1973 Dom Ruinart Blanc de Blancs Brut is a 【spectacularly good vintage for Champagne】, known for its elegance and delicacy. The growing season saw a benign spring and a hot, dry summer, leading to a large harvest of high-quality grapes, despite some challenges with rot for Chardonnay. This fully resolved, mature Champagne offers a soft, creamy texture with captivating aromas of honey, roasted nuts, and licorice. Some bottles may even show an incredibly youthful character with fresh citrus, lemon tart, and mousse, gaining weight and power in the glass. 🍴 This aged Blanc de Blancs pairs beautifully with refined dishes. Think shellfish, crab, lobster, or delicate fish preparations. Its complexity also makes it a wonderful companion to a variety of seafood dishes. 🥂 An extraordinary choice for a landmark anniversary or a truly special celebration, offering a rare glimpse into Champagne's past. This is a wine for contemplation and appreciation of its historical journey. Given its age, expect potential variations in cork and capsule condition. Serve at a slightly warmer temperature than young Champagne, around 10-12°C (50-54°F), in a tulip-shaped glass to allow its complex, evolved aromatics to fully express themselves. Decanting is generally not recommended for old Champagne unless there's significant sediment, which is rare for sparkling wine.
BACKGROUND
Champagne Ruinart was one of the first Champagne houses, established in 1729. It takes its name from the Benedictine monk Dom Ruinart, whose writings on Champagne were passed down through his family and resulted in the Maison Ruinart we know today.Dom Ruinart was born in Champagne in 1657, and died in 1709. He moved from his home to an abbey just outside of Paris, where he began to learn about the "wine with bubbles", which was very popular among the young aristocrats of the time. He believed it could be made best on the soils of his hometown. Upon his death in 1709, he left many books containing his writings on this to his nephew Nicolas Ruinart and, 20 years later, Maison Ruinart was founded.
